    I have some once-fired military 5.56 brass that I have reconditioned as follows:

    5.56mm

    1. Inspect all brass and discard as appropriate;
    2. De-primed;
    3. Wet Polished in a Big Dawg Tumbler for 4 hours with stainless steel media, Lemme Shine, and Dawn;
    4. Swagged using a Dillon Super Swage 600;
    5. Re-sized on a Redding Competition Full Length Sizing Die;
    6. Trimmed to SAAMI Spec'd Length - 1.760;
    7. Chamfer / Deburred; and
    8. Visually Inspected.
    300 BLK

    1. Inspect all brass and discard as appropriate;
    2. Deprimed;
    3. Trim Case Length;
    4. Wet Polished in a Big Dawg Tumbler for 4 hours with stainless steel media, Lemme Shine, and Dawn;
    5. Swagged using a Dillon Super Swage 600;
    6. Re-sized on a Redding Competition Full Length Sizing Die;
    7. Trimmed to SAAMI Spec'd Length - 1.368;
    8. Chamfer / Deburred; and
    9. Visually Inspected.
    I use Mitutoyo Absolute 500-197-20 digital calipers for all measurements.
